UK national chargesheeted for high commission stir

NEW DELHI: NIA on Thursday chargesheeted an Indian-origin UK national for allegedly playing a key role in last year's violent protests at Indian High Commission in London.

The protests were organised to express solidarity with the chief of pro-Khalistan outfit Waaris Punjab De, Amritpal Singh, after Punjab cops launched a manhunt against him.

Inderpal Singh Gaba, a UK national residing in Hounslow and originally from New Delhi, was one of the agitators who had actively participated in the anti-India protest on March 22, 2023 in front of the Indian high commission "as part of the Khalistani secessionist agenda", NIA said, quoting chargesheet.

Objects were hurled, anti-India slogans shouted, and Khalistani flags raised by agitators during the protest, which incidentally followed barely three days after pro-Khalistan protestors had tried to storm Indian embassy and pulled down the tricolour hoisted there.

Gaba was arrested by NIA on April 25 though he was detained earlier on Dec 23, 2023, by Indian immigration authorities at Attari border.
